The first time we had heard of Damwon Gaming was at 2018 Worlds in which the majority of teams were telling us during their interviews about how good the junior Korean team was in scrims, and how they'll dominate the world in 2019 when they compete in LCK. They didn't live up to their hype the next year. Damwon Gaming had a little increase in their performance later in the year and was able to qualify for Worlds but their performance wasn't really impressive as they fell to G2 Esports in the quarter-finals. In the year that they bought Ghost from Sandbox Gaming and their results increased with each game they played. Damwon is just one step away of the ultimate honor in "League of Legends" and also being part of the elite team to lift the "Summoner’s Cup". However, many are interested in the players, and from where they came from. That's why we will walk through the past and tell a brief story about the five players who started.

Top: Nuguri

A hard-working teenager who loved playing videogames is the way to describe Nuguri in the early days of his professional life, but with time he started to focus on League of Legends far more than his studies. He participated in an internet cafe tournament and received his first offer to join a professional group and participated in IGS for a whole year. There Nuguri was spotted by Damwon Gaming, who wanted Nuguri to be their starting top laner for their main team. Nuguri not only brought his incredible ability to Damwon Gaming, but also his lively personality. One could not really describe the importance of this in a professional setting. Nuguri rose quickly to prominence in Korean SoloQ. The players feared him due to his amazing laning and team fighting. However, Nuguri still believes he has much to learn. His desire to win the Summoner's Cup has changed. He is more determined than ever to become the most successful player on the field. Jungler: Canyon

Canyon is the only player in the history of LCK to earn the pentakill, but his path to reach this point has been filled with a few difficult moments. Canyon was a member of Damwon Gaming late 2018, and was a key part of the scrims Kings' time. However, Canyon played among the top junglers around the world at 17 years old. It was certainly thrilling for him to beat them. Canyon continued to do the same in 2019 but slowly others caught on to his tactics and that affected the results of Damwon Gaming.

Canyon Damwon and Canyon Damwon worked hard throughout the year until they made it to the promised country. Their biggest accomplishment was their revenge on G2 Esports last Wednesday during the semi-finals. Canyon has finally beaten every single jungler that he lost to last year and the only thing stopping him from winning the Summoner's Cup this week is Suning Gaming.

Mid: Showmaker

It is evident in his interviews that Showmaker is the most competitive player on the team. When asked to rank how crucial his contribution is to the current performance of the team, Showmaker replied: "I am feeling like, even when I win, I get carried away and when I lose I don't have any presence". Showmaker admitted that it's difficult for players in their 20s to carry the hopes and cheers of a multitude of supporters every week. Everyone on the team trusts Showmaker and frequently say that he is the most vocal member of the team, however Showmaker, a young midlaner, has often admitted to doubting himself often.

Showmaker stated in an interview that this was his best tournament, but soon afterwards he said that he believes it is the worst. G2 Esports were on Showmaker's minds throughout the year. He would always talk about how he wanted revenge for the loss last year. We witnessed how pleased the team was last weekend. Showmaker was always spamming emotes, and even stole G2 Esports post-game celebration to demonstrate that he isn't willing to accept any disrespect to his team or his region. We'll be seeing an Showmaker who is more comfortable and confident with the past, as his eyes are on the future.

Support: Beryl

Damwon Gaming's primary shot-caller is Beryl. He is the longest-running member of Damwon Gaming and has been playing for the longest period of time. Beryl was previously an ADC but after Nuclear joined Damwon Gaming from H2K, the team agreed to share time with Hoit as the support player for the team. Beryl was always on the sidelines, seeking out more information about his teammates and the video game itself, however Coach Kim was not consistent with his team selection and he was never given the chance to demonstrate his skills as a top class support. In the year that Coach Zefa was in charge, Beryl finally got that chance and showed his true potential throughout the year. Damwon Gaming players joke that Baryl isn't just the supportplayer, as well as a great player as well as a jungler and ADC for their team. This is because of the amount of time he spends on the field and assists his teammates from every angle. Beryl can be described as the veteran who plays a big brother to those who are new to the game. I think he is a many CoreJJ players from the 2017 Samsung Galaxy, which won Worlds. Beryl will challenge his team to their highest level in the battle against Suning Gaming this week, and he will defend them.
